Coalton, IL vs Loami, IL
Coalton, IL and Loami, IL have a very similar cost of living, with only a 4.9% difference in their overall index. Coalton scores 64 while Loami scores 67 on the cost of living index, where 100 represents the national average. The day-to-day expenses for residents in both cities are comparable, though differences emerge when looking at specific categories.
On the housing front, median rent in Coalton is $775/month compared to $871/month in Loami — a 11%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Coalton is more affordable at $81,000 median vs $108,800.
Median household income in Coalton is $76,250 compared to $53,750 in Loami (+41.9%). Coalton offers a double advantage: higher earnings combined with a lower cost of living, giving residents significantly more purchasing power. Looking at affordability, residents of Coalton spend roughly 12.2% of their income on rent, less than the 19.4% in Loami.
